WebAlternative dosing strategies, such as extended infusions, should be considered for time-dependent antibiotics (e.g., β-lactams) in obese patients to achieve PD targets reliably. … WebIndicated for uncomplicated gonococcal infection of pharynx, cervix, urethra, or rectum. Weight <150 kg: Ceftriaxone 500 mg IM once. Weight ≥150 kg: Ceftriaxone 1,000 mg IM once. If chlamydial infection has not been excluded, add doxycycline 100 mg BID x 7 days, or if pregnant give azithromycin 1,000 mg.
